Yes, you can send a boarding pass through text. Most airlines offer the option to receive a mobile boarding pass via SMS or through their app. Simply opt-in for this service when checking in online. This digital pass can be scanned at security checkpoints and boarding gates, streamlining your travel experience and reducing the need for printed documents.

FAQs & Answers

  1. Can I use a boarding pass sent by text at all airports? Most airports accept boarding passes sent via text message or mobile apps, but it’s best to check with your specific airline and airport to confirm compatibility.
  2. Is a mobile boarding pass as secure as a printed one? Yes, mobile boarding passes use unique barcodes or QR codes that are secure and verifiable at checkpoints, offering convenience without compromising security.
  3. How do I get a boarding pass sent through text message? During online check-in, opt to receive your boarding pass via SMS or through your airline’s mobile app to have it sent directly to your phone.
  4. What should I do if I lose my mobile boarding pass on my phone? If you lose your boarding pass, you can usually retrieve it by logging back into the airline’s app or website, or request assistance at the airport check-in counter.
